iPhone Air 2 Tipped for Ultra-wide Camera

Last updated: January 27, 2026 6:40 am
Share
iPhone Air 2 Tipped for Ultra-wide Camera
SHARE

The iPhone Air 2 is rumored to address the major flaw of its predecessor by incorporating a dedicated ultra-wide camera alongside the main wide lens. According to reports, Apple is working on custom ultra-thin Face ID components to create space for the second camera, aiming to improve the overall camera system of the device.

In a review of the original iPhone Air, one of the main criticisms was the lack of a complete camera system for a device priced at ÂŁ999. With only a single 48MP rear camera, users were left wanting for more versatility and options in their photography experience.

The future of the iPhone Air remains uncertain, with reports suggesting that sales of the slim device have been poor since its launch. However, Apple’s investment in the design technology of the iPhone Air could potentially influence the development of its upcoming foldable iPhone, expected to launch later this year at a price point of around $2,399.
